You will need the crank case breather but the other is optional, I suggest putting the probe into the airflow by making a hole in a filter on a TB. Of course the other way is to just lay it on top of the valve cover, the filter is to protect it from damage and grime.

Yes, you can just install the GiPro all by itself with no other modifications necessary. It is just tricking the ECU by making it think you are in 4th or 5th gears so the 7% factory power reduction is bypassed. no fuel trim's are changed by using one.

I've done all the Power Commander route stuff, PCIII, triples, GiPro, secondaries etc ... and I take it on trips, Niagara Falls double-up with luggage, and never had any reliability issues.

Hiya Johnny thought I would throw in my recent experiences as they relate to the work you are doing.
Regarding removing the secondary plates they are held in with 2 M4 I think screws which are quite tight as the ends are peened over to prevent them vibrating loose.
Note- these should not be used again, either buy new ones or use thread lock if you decide to re- fit the secondary plates.Also be careful these screws do not drop into the fuel injection system, a magnetic screwdriver is useful.
Now the tricky bit, if you are fitting tripple K&N filters its no problem but otherwise re-fitting of the plastic plenum is a bloody nightmare. To assist lube up the insides of the 3 inlets of the plenum just enough to make it slippery, also a long thin flat bladed screwdriver helps to get the plenum seated correctly as you dont want any leaks.
Finaly if you have lifted the tank up and sat it on the wand{ I made a longer one from a steel rod), just check that none of the vacuum pipes have come loose as this will make the engine backfire etc.
